Sources: NBA discussions include Christmas start

The NBA’s board of governors on Friday is discussing possible changes to plans for the 2020-21 season, including starting as quickly as possible, playing fewer than 82 games and not waiting for fans to be permitted to all league arenas, sources told ESPN.
